Harrison Scott Associates is looking for a professional in Birmingham to drive UK strapping sales. Responsibilities include building market share, managing accounts, and identifying growth opportunities.
The ideal candidate will have experience in the UK Packaging Market and strong communication skills. A competitive salary package and benefits are offered for this role, which focuses on enhancing the company's portfolio and trading performance.
